LSPDFR Crashing After Reinstall

Featured Replies

Just had to do a fresh install of GTAV and LSPDFR. Got everything as updates as I could from this site and the RPH Discord. Started game once into story mode at first, added 100% game file, then added a bunch of car mods, ELS, LSPDFR, and a few other things. Now RPH crashes. If I uninstall LSPDFR, RPH will load just fine into story mode and all my addon cars/ELS/etc work just fine - but adding LSPDFR into the mix causes an immediate crash. Log attached. It looks like it just hangs up loading the plugin and crashes. I did change my plugin load time to 12000. It did not help - it just takes a bit longer for the crash to happen. 

 

I don't think it's a game config issue or GTAV corruption since the game loads in vanilla and non-LSPDFR RPH forms just fine - why would RPH be hanging me up/crashing?
